Hard Drive Degaussing Services in Philadelphia

Degaussing exposes magnetic storage platters to a powerful electromagnetic field that permanently randomizes all stored data, rendering the drive inoperable and the data irretrievable. For Philadelphia's financial sector organizations including Independence Blue Cross and multi-site enterprise operations, degaussing is the fastest path to NIST SP 800-88 Rev. 1 Purge-level compliance when drives are being decommissioned rather than redeployed. The process takes seconds per drive, enabling rapid processing of large-volume enterprise decommissioning projects that would take days using software-based erasure methods. Degaussed drives cannot be returned to service, making this method appropriate for end-of-life assets only.

When Philadelphia organizations need magnetic erasure verified to federal standards, STS uses NSA/CSS EPL listed degaussing equipment satisfying National Security Agency evaluation criteria. Unlike software-based wiping, magnetic erasure eliminates all data regardless of file system, operating system, or encryption state. For organizations needing post-degauss physical destruction, we pair degaussing with our Philadelphia hard drive shredding services to satisfy the most stringent disposal requirements. Per NIST SP 800-88 Rev. 1, degaussing followed by physical destruction represents the highest available sanitization level.

An important technical distinction: degaussing is effective only on magnetic storage media. Solid-state drives, USB flash drives, and NVMe devices are not affected by magnetic fields and require physical shredding or software-based NIST-compliant erasure. During consultation, STS audits your media inventory to identify which assets qualify for degaussing and which require alternative destruction methods. Mixed environments are common in Philadelphia enterprise settings, and STS manages both streams in a single coordinated engagement with unified documentation across all media types.

Tape & Archive Media Degaussing

Enterprise backup environments accumulate LTO tape libraries, DLT and SDLT cartridges, DAT and DDS tapes, and legacy reel-to-reel formats containing years of sensitive organizational data. When tape rotation schedules end or archive systems are decommissioned, certified degaussing ensures complete magnetic erasure before disposal. Jefferson Health's multi-hospital network and Children's Hospital of Philadelphia (CHOP), with 16,000+ employees, routinely retire backup tape libraries requiring HIPAA-compliant magnetic media sanitization. Backup tapes often contain multiple generations of sensitive data accumulated over years of business operations, making verified destruction documentation especially critical for demonstrating regulatory compliance to auditors.

STS degausses all standard magnetic tape formats to NSA/CSS EPL and NIST SP 800-88 standards. Degaussed tape cartridges are rendered permanently unreadable with no possibility of data recovery by any means. Regulatory pressure on tape media destruction has increased significantly as data protection frameworks tighten. Under HIPAA 45 CFR §164.312(a)(2)(iv), electronic PHI stored on backup media must be rendered irretrievable before disposal, making certified degaussing documentation essential for covered entities and business associates throughout the Philadelphia healthcare network. Financial organizations subject to the GLBA Safeguards Rule and SEC recordkeeping requirements face similar destruction obligations for backup tapes containing customer financial data. How does degaussing differ from hard drive shredding?

Degaussing uses a powerful magnetic field to erase all data on magnetic media, permanently disabling the device. It is faster for large HDD and tape volumes and meets NIST SP 800-88 Purge-level requirements. Physical shredding provides a visible, irreversible result often required by government clients or for mixed media environments including SSDs and flash storage that cannot be degaussed.
